My Journey with Eczema (Part 3)


PART 3

As bad as the itch was in the day, it got worse at nights. This meant many sleepless nights.

Some persons think that the itching is worse at nights because we are not able to apply eczema lotion as frequently at nights, as we do during the day.

I would wake up about 3 times per night because of the itching, and when I do sleep, I would scratch my hands in my sleep. 

Sometimes my hands would get so dry that it would literally crack, and in the mornings, I would awake to bleeding hands. Yes, a painful experience.

So eventually I had to start sleeping in eczema gloves to prevent me from scratching and also to maintain the moisture in my skin while I sleep.

The scratching causes the rash to ooze pus and cause scabby areas. The best way I can describe the result is “crocodile-like” skin.

I felt I could relate personally to Job, in the Bible. He was struck with painful boils and would use a piece of broken pottery to scratch himself. 

Yes, I knew exactly how he felt, that itch would just not scratch…

Then there is the additional stress of persons constantly staring.
